Understanding the Basics: What Makes an AI-Driven Chatbot?

Before we delve into the practical applications and real-world case studies, let's first understand the core components of an AI-driven chatbot. At its essence, an AI-driven chatbot is a machine learning model that can understand and respond to natural language inputs from users. These chatbots are designed to mimic human conversation and provide relevant, timely responses to user queries. The key to a successful chatbot lies in its ability to learn from interactions, adapt to user behavior, and continuously improve its performance.

# Key Components of an AI-Driven Chatbot

1. Natural Language Processing (NLP): NLP enables the chatbot to understand and interpret human language, making the interaction feel more natural and human-like.

2. Machine Learning: Machine learning algorithms are used to train the chatbot to recognize patterns and improve its responses over time.

3. Contextual Understanding: The ability to maintain context throughout a conversation is crucial for providing relevant and helpful responses.

4. Integrations: Connecting the chatbot to various systems and services ensures that it can provide comprehensive support and integrate seamlessly into your existing workflows.

Practical Applications: Real-World Case Studies

Now that we have a basic understanding of what goes into building an AI-driven chatbot, let's explore some real-world applications and case studies to see how these chatbots are making a difference in various industries.

# Case Study 1: Customer Support for a Retail Giant

A leading global retailer decided to enhance its customer support experience by implementing an AI-driven chatbot. The chatbot was designed to handle common customer inquiries, such as order tracking, return policies, and product availability. The result was a significant reduction in the number of calls to the customer service hotline, leading to cost savings and improved customer satisfaction. This case study highlights how chatbots can be effectively used to offload routine tasks and improve service efficiency.

# Case Study 2: Personalized Recommendations for a Retail E-commerce Platform

An e-commerce platform used an AI-driven chatbot to provide personalized product recommendations to its users. The chatbot analyzed user behavior and preferences to suggest products that were most likely to interest them. This not only improved the user experience but also led to a noticeable increase in conversion rates. The case study demonstrates how chatbots can leverage data to provide personalized and relevant content, driving business growth.

Challenges and Future Directions

While AI-driven chatbots offer numerous benefits, there are also challenges that need to be addressed. Issues such as ensuring data privacy, maintaining user trust, and handling complex queries are critical considerations. As the technology continues to evolve, we can expect to see more advanced chatbots that are even more integrated with other systems and capable of handling a wider range of tasks.

# Future Directions

1. Enhanced Personalization: Chatbots will become even better at understanding and predicting user needs, leading to more personalized interactions.

2. Integration with Wearables and IoT Devices: Chatbots will be increasingly integrated with wearable devices and IoT devices, creating new opportunities for seamless user interactions.
